The Science Behind Detoxification and How a Juice Cleanse Supports It

Detoxification is a complex physiological process that primarily takes place in the liver, where toxins are broken down and converted into forms that can be excreted through the kidneys, lungs, and intestines. The process involves two primary phases: Phase I, where enzymes break down toxins into intermediate substances, and Phase II, where these intermediates are further processed for safe elimination. The efficiency of detoxification is influenced by nutrient availability, hydration, and overall metabolic health. A 5-day juice cleanse provides the body with essential nutrients such as vitamin C, glutathione, and polyphenols, which support these detoxification pathways.

Cruciferous vegetables like kale, broccoli, and cabbage contain compounds that enhance liver enzyme activity, aiding in Phase I and Phase II detoxification. Ingredients like lemon and ginger support the body’s alkaline balance and improve digestive function. Additionally, beets and carrots provide betaine and carotenoids, which have been shown to support liver function. Unlike extreme fasting or restrictive detox regimens, a juice cleanse supplies ample nutrients that help prevent metabolic slowdowns and muscle breakdown while promoting cellular repair and renewal.

Risks and Considerations of a Colon Cleanse

While colon cleansing may offer benefits, it is not without potential risks. One of the primary concerns associated with a 7 day colon cleanse is dehydration. Certain cleansing methods, including laxatives and high-fiber supplements, can increase bowel movements, potentially leading to excessive fluid loss and electrolyte imbalances. It is crucial to maintain proper hydration throughout the cleanse by drinking sufficient water and replenishing lost electrolytes.

Another concern is the potential for nutrient deficiencies. If a 7 day detox cleanse involves strict dietary restrictions or excessive fasting, individuals may not consume adequate macronutrients and essential vitamins. While short-term cleansing is unlikely to cause severe deficiencies, it is important to ensure that nutrient-dense foods and supplements are included in the cleanse plan.

Some colon cleanse products, particularly stimulant laxatives, may cause dependency if used excessively. Ingredients such as cascara sagrada and senna can stimulate bowel movements, but frequent use may lead to decreased natural bowel function over time. To avoid dependency, it is best to use these products as directed and prioritize dietary sources of fiber for long-term digestive health.

Individuals with pre-existing medical conditions, such as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), Crohn’s disease, or diverticulitis, should consult a healthcare professional before starting a 7 day colon cleanse. Certain cleansing methods may exacerbate symptoms or lead to complications in individuals with sensitive digestive systems.

Common Challenges and Potential Risks of a Juice Cleanse

While the benefits of a 7 day juice detox are widely discussed, it is equally important to consider the potential challenges and risks. One of the most significant concerns is the high sugar content of fruit-based juices. Without fiber to slow down sugar absorption, fruit juices can cause rapid spikes in blood sugar levels, which may lead to energy crashes, mood fluctuations, and insulin resistance over time. Individuals with diabetes or metabolic disorders should exercise caution when undertaking a one week juice fast and opt for vegetable-based juices with lower glycemic impact.

Another common challenge associated with a 7 day juice fast is hunger and fatigue. The absence of protein and healthy fats can lead to muscle breakdown and reduced satiety, making it difficult for some individuals to maintain energy levels throughout the cleanse. Additionally, inadequate intake of essential amino acids may impair immune function, slow down metabolic rate, and contribute to the loss of lean muscle mass.

Electrolyte imbalances are also a potential concern during a 7 day juice cleanse. While fresh juices provide certain minerals, they may lack sufficient sodium, calcium, and other electrolytes required for nerve function, muscle contractions, and overall fluid balance. To mitigate this risk, some individuals supplement their cleanse with bone broth, coconut water, or herbal teas to ensure adequate electrolyte intake.

Understanding the Mechanisms of a 7 Day Liquid Fast

At its core, fasting shifts the body’s energy utilization processes. In the absence of solid food, the body transitions from relying on glucose derived from carbohydrates to breaking down stored fat and producing ketones for energy. This metabolic shift, known as ketosis, typically occurs within 24 to 72 hours of fasting, depending on individual factors such as glycogen stores, activity levels, and previous dietary habits. During a 7 day liquid fast, the body undergoes a series of adaptive responses aimed at preserving essential functions while utilizing alternative fuel sources.

One of the most well-documented physiological effects of fasting is autophagy, a cellular process in which the body recycles damaged cells and removes dysfunctional components. Research suggests that autophagy plays a crucial role in reducing inflammation, supporting immune function, and potentially slowing down the aging process. Additionally, fasting triggers hormonal changes, including increased human growth hormone (HGH) production, which can aid in muscle preservation and fat metabolism. However, prolonged fasting without proper nutritional support may also lead to undesirable effects, such as electrolyte imbalances and decreased lean muscle mass.

Risks and Challenges of a 7 Day Liquid Fast

While a 7 day liquid fast can offer potential health benefits, it is not without risks. One of the primary concerns is nutrient deficiencies, as abstaining from solid foods can lead to insufficient intake of essential vitamins and minerals. Prolonged fasting without proper supplementation may result in deficiencies in potassium, magnesium, sodium, and other electrolytes necessary for nerve function, muscle contractions, and overall cellular health. Symptoms of electrolyte imbalances can include dizziness, heart palpitations, muscle cramps, and fatigue.

Another challenge associated with extended liquid fasting is muscle loss. Although fasting can promote fat oxidation, prolonged caloric restriction can also lead to the breakdown of lean muscle tissue for energy. While the presence of HGH during fasting may help mitigate muscle loss to some extent, consuming protein-rich broths or amino acid supplements may be beneficial in preserving muscle mass during a 7 day liquid diet.

Furthermore, fasting may cause disruptions in metabolic rate. While short-term fasting has been shown to improve metabolic flexibility, excessive caloric restriction over extended periods may trigger the body’s adaptive response to conserve energy, leading to a slowed metabolism. This effect is particularly concerning for individuals who engage in repeated long-duration fasts without adequate refeeding periods, as it can make long-term weight management more challenging.
